数据表的结构如下 CREATE TABLE IF NOT EXISTS `user_log` ( `id` varchar(100) NOT NULL default '0', `username` varchar(30) NOT NULL, `time` bigint(13) NOT NULL default '0', `result` tinyint(1) NOT NULL default '0', `money` bigint(40) NOT NULL default '0', PRIMARY KEY (`id`,`username`,`time`), KEY `username` (`id`), KEY `username_2` (`id`) ) ENGINE=MyISAM DEFAULT CHARSET=latin1; -- --...
date -d "1970-01-01 UTC 1210729632 seconds" 使用这个命令可以在unix时间戳和可读的时间格式之间进行转换。 本文来自Chinaunix博客,如果查看原文请点:http://blog.chinaunix.net/u1/40133/showart_687421.html
总结一下java 时间戳和php时间戳 的转换问题: 由于精度不同,导致长度不一致,直接转换错误。 JAVA时间戳长度是13位,如:1294890876859 php时间戳长度是10位, 如:1294890859 主要最后三位的不同,JAVA时间戳在php中使用,去掉后三位,如:1294890876859-> 1294890876 结果:2011-01-13 11:54:36[code]echo date('Y-m-d H:i:s','1294890876');[/code]php时间戳在JAVA中使用,最后加三位,用000补充,如:1294890859->1294890...
我这里有一个日志logtime logtime日志内容: 1255723142|NONE|CCVST|SIP/2324|UNPAUSE| 1255723142|NONE|CCGST|SIP/2324|UNPAUSE| 1255723203|NONE|CCISO|SIP/2324|UNPAUSE| 1255723203|NONE|CCVST|SIP/2324|UNPAUSE| 1255723203|NONE|CCGST|SIP/2324|UNPAUSE| 1255723256|NONE|CCISO|SIP/2324|UNPAUSE| 1255723256|NONE|CCVST|SIP/2324|UNPAUSE| 1255723256|NONE|CCGST|SIP/2324|UNPAUSE| 1255723263|NONE|CCISO|SIP/2324|UNPAUSE...
最近因禁止某个目录返回这个信息,想想真不安全, Forbidden You don't have permission to access /bbs on this server. -------------------------------------------------------------------------------- Apache/2.0.50 (unix) php/5.1.2 Server at www.test.com Port 80 太不安全了,请问各位大哥,有办法不显示吗? 谢谢!
最近因禁止某个目录返回这个信息,想想真不安全, Forbidden You don't have permission to access /bbs on this server. -------------------------------------------------------------------------------- Apache/2.0.50 (unix) php/5.1.2 Server at www.test.com Port 80 太不安全了,请问各位大哥,有办法不显示吗? 谢谢!
获取当前unix时间戳,就是1970年以来的妙数,用 date +%s 可是我要计算某天的时间戳改怎么写? 比如2010-10-12 12:25:00这个时间的时间戳是多少? 还有我知道这个时间戳的妙数,如何计算对应时间? 比如1341213505是什么时间?
php中如何实现日期转化为时间戳? 例如有如下格式时间:$date=2005-10-19 则如何把$date转化为时间戳呢? [ 本帖最后由 HonestQiao 于 2005-11-27 19:13 编辑 ]
各位, 从别的资料中,看到将unix时间戳转换为日期时间可以使用如下两种方法: date -d @1281161747 或者 date -d '1970-01-01 UTC 1281161747 seconds' 后一种很好理解,-d 后是字符串表示的时间,前一个命令中的@符号有什么特殊含义,不加还报错呢? 先谢谢了!